In today’s digital world, understanding online safety is crucial. Students use the internet for learning, socialising, and entertainment, but it’s important to know how to stay safe online. Terms like password, privacy, and block help protect personal information and ensure positive online experiences. While issues like cyberbullying and spam can make the internet feel unsafe, knowing and understanding them can be empowering. This word list includes key terms related to online safety and cyberbullying, providing example sentences to help students protect themselves and others while navigating the online world.

privacy |
Privacy refers to keeping your personal information safe and only sharing it with trusted people.
|
|
password |
A password is a secret word or code used to protect your accounts and devices.
|
|
spam |
Spam is unwanted or junk email or messages sent to many people.
|
|
report |
To report means to tell someone about harmful or inappropriate content.
|
|
block |
If you block someone, it means you prevent them from contacting you or viewing your content.
|
|
phishing |
Phishing is when someone tries to trick you into sharing your personal information.
|
|
scam |
A scam is a dishonest scheme designed to trick people out of money or information.
|
|
malware |
Malware is harmful software that can damage your computer or steal your information.
|
|
cyberbullying |
Cyberbullying is when someone uses the internet to hurt, threaten, or humiliate others.
|
|
verification |
Two-step verification adds an extra layer of security by requiring two forms of identification to access an account.
|
|
terms |
Terms of service are the rules a website or app sets for using their services.

troll |
A troll is someone who posts rude and offensive messages online.
|
|
hacking |
Hacking is when someone illegally breaks into a computer system or account.
|
|
digital |
Your digital footprint is the trail of information you leave behind when using the internet.
